Regulation of the chick cutaneous innervation pattern in retinoic acid-induced ectopic feathers and in the naked neck mutant.
The International journal of developmental biology - 1 Aug 1997
Pays L, Hemming F J, Saxod R
Abstract excerpt
In chick skin, nerve fibers develop in a typical network formed by arcades around the base of feathers. In this study, we tried to dissociate the morphogenesis of nerve arcades and feathers, and to clarify the implication of several matricial molecules in these two developmental events. For this...
